Omega-3 Fatty Acids from Fish Reduce Risks of Heart Disease and Other Conditions
Consuming fish, rich in omega-3 fatty acids, demonstrably reduces risks of heart disease, stroke, dementia, and inflammatory conditions; the American Heart Association recommends at least two servings weekly.
